Jon Mulder, head of product marketing for North America said,”We’re going to be really focused on this device starting in the second quarter.” Availability of the Sony Ericsson 8-megapixel C905 Cybershot is confirmed.

Although not sure whether the GSM phone will be available through T-Mobile or AT&T, the handset is estimated to be around 199 to $249 here after carrier subsidies. The phone previously available in Europe for 400 euro. The US price will probably see customers tied into a two year contract.
Sony Ericsson says consumers are be keener than ever to have a high-quality camera with them at all times. As for phones, the trend for sharing everyday photographs on social networks such as Facebook. Analysts worry consumers might not be willing to pay the premium. NPD analyst Ross Rubin said, “It’s a challenging case to make, particularly in this age where we’re seeing standalone 8 megapixel cameras offered for $100 or less.” The 8 megapixel device comes amid news of a 12 megapixel beast.
